Fly Blade JV to launch on-demand helicopter flights in India—Mumbai–Pune and Shirdi beginning March 2019

Fly Blade Inc., positioning itself as an “Uber of helicopters,” says it will start India operations in March 2019 via a joint venture with Hunch Ventures. The initial service will operate intercity routes between Mumbai and Pune, with Shirdi added as the operation ramps, starting from intracity operations.
